100 Thrones & Patriots gold winners announced
Look inside to see if you're one of the 100 lucky GameSpot Complete members to win a gold copy of the upcoming Rise of Nations expansion.
Sign-ups for GameSpot's Rise of Nations: Thrones & Patriots Gold Giveaway ended on April 14, and we've picked 100 lucky winners from the list of eligible entries. Each of the 100 winners will receive an early "gold" copy of the game from Microsoft. One of the 100 will later receive the grand prize--a set of autographed copies of Rise of Nations and Rise of Nations: Thrones & Patriots.
